For decades, the most effective treatments for cancer have involved surgery and rounds of chemotherapy or radiation. But some of those treatments can harm healthy cells, which is why advancements that harness the power of the immune system are a big deal.
“Some patients have truly remarkable responses to immunotherapy that last for years—in some cases so many years that we think these patients may even be cured of their disease,” says Ezra Cohen, M.D., codirector of the Precision Immunotherapy…
